| 正面描述 | Bare-headed right-facing effigy of Queen Elizabeth II after the fourth portrait by Ian Rank-Broadley, rendered in high relief against a mirror-polished field. The legend ELIZABETH II arcs along the lower left rim, continuing with BAILIWICK OF GUERNSEY around the upper portion of the coin. The engraver's initials IRB appear truncated at the neck. A small floral spray device is present at the lower right of the effigy. |

Guernsey's millennium coinage was issued under the authority of the States of Guernsey, a body that has retained the right to issue its own currency independently of the UK since the Bailiwick was never formally incorporated into the United Kingdom. The year 2000 prompted a wave of commemorative issues across British Crown Dependencies, and Guernsey's output was no exception — gold-plated silver pieces like this one were produced specifically for the collector market rather than circulation.
KM#87 is one of several denomination variants struck for the millennium series, each sharing the same plating specification over .925 silver.
